-package bwrap
-
-type Config struct {
- // unshare every namespace we support by default if nil
- // (--unshare-all)
- Unshare *UnshareConfig `json:"unshare,omitempty"`
- // retain the network namespace (can only combine with nil Unshare)
- // (--share-net)
- Net bool `json:"net"`
-
- // disable further use of user namespaces inside sandbox and fail unless
- // further use of user namespace inside sandbox is disabled if false
- // (--disable-userns) (--assert-userns-disabled)
- UserNS bool `json:"userns"`
-
- // custom uid in the sandbox, requires new user namespace
- // (--uid UID)
- UID *int `json:"uid,omitempty"`
- // custom gid in the sandbox, requires new user namespace
- // (--gid GID)
- GID *int `json:"gid,omitempty"`
- // custom hostname in the sandbox, requires new uts namespace
- // (--hostname NAME)
- Hostname string `json:"hostname,omitempty"`
-
- // change directory
- // (--chdir DIR)
- Chdir string `json:"chdir,omitempty"`
- // unset all environment variables
- // (--clearenv)
- Clearenv bool `json:"clearenv"`
- // set environment variable
- // (--setenv VAR VALUE)
- SetEnv map[string]string `json:"setenv,omitempty"`
- // unset environment variables
- // (--unsetenv VAR)
- UnsetEnv []string `json:"unsetenv,omitempty"`
-
- // take a lock on file while sandbox is running
- // (--lock-file DEST)
- LockFile []string `json:"lock_file,omitempty"`
-
- // ordered filesystem args
- Filesystem []FSBuilder `json:"filesystem,omitempty"`
-
- // change permissions (must already exist)
- // (--chmod OCTAL PATH)
- Chmod ChmodConfig `json:"chmod,omitempty"`
-
- // load and use seccomp rules from FD (not repeatable)
- // (--seccomp FD)
- Syscall *SyscallPolicy
-
- // create a new terminal session
- // (--new-session)
- NewSession bool `json:"new_session"`
- // kills with SIGKILL child process (COMMAND) when bwrap or bwrap's parent dies.
- // (--die-with-parent)
- DieWithParent bool `json:"die_with_parent"`
- // do not install a reaper process with PID=1
- // (--as-pid-1)
- AsInit bool `json:"as_init"`
-
- /* unmapped options include:
- --unshare-user-try Create new user namespace if possible else continue by skipping it
- --unshare-cgroup-try Create new cgroup namespace if possible else continue by skipping it
- --userns FD Use this user namespace (cannot combine with --unshare-user)
- --userns2 FD After setup switch to this user namespace, only useful with --userns
- --pidns FD Use this pid namespace (as parent namespace if using --unshare-pid)
- --bind-fd FD DEST Bind open directory or path fd on DEST
- --ro-bind-fd FD DEST Bind open directory or path fd read-only on DEST
- --exec-label LABEL Exec label for the sandbox
- --file-label LABEL File label for temporary sandbox content
- --add-seccomp-fd FD Load and use seccomp rules from FD (repeatable)
- --block-fd FD Block on FD until some data to read is available
- --userns-block-fd FD Block on FD until the user namespace is ready
- --info-fd FD Write information about the running container to FD
- --json-status-fd FD Write container status to FD as multiple JSON documents
- --cap-add CAP Add cap CAP when running as privileged user
- --cap-drop CAP Drop cap CAP when running as privileged user
-
- among which --args is used internally for passing arguments */
-}
-
-type UnshareConfig struct {
- // (--unshare-user)
- // create new user namespace
- User bool `json:"user"`
- // (--unshare-ipc)
- // create new ipc namespace
- IPC bool `json:"ipc"`
- // (--unshare-pid)
- // create new pid namespace
- PID bool `json:"pid"`
- // (--unshare-net)
- // create new network namespace
- Net bool `json:"net"`
- // (--unshare-uts)
- // create new uts namespace
- UTS bool `json:"uts"`
- // (--unshare-cgroup)
- // create new cgroup namespace
- CGroup bool `json:"cgroup"`
-}
